Professional Cameras Still Have Their Place: Why They Aren’t Obsolete Yet
Okay, so phone cameras are getting incredible night photography results. But let’s not declare the professional camera dead just yet. There are still some key areas where dedicated cameras excel, and I think, continue to justify their existence. Sensor size is one of the most significant factors. Larger sensors, found in DSLRs and mirrorless cameras, capture more light. More light means less noise and better dynamic range. In my opinion, this is where the difference becomes truly apparent, especially when you start printing your photos or viewing them on a large screen. You can see the details that are simply missing in phone images.
Beyond sensor size, lens options also give professional cameras a significant edge. With interchangeable lenses, you can choose the perfect glass for the job. Whether it’s a wide-angle for landscapes or a telephoto for wildlife, the possibilities are endless. Phone cameras, while improving, are still limited by their fixed lenses. While some offer “zoom” features, it’s often just digital zoom, which degrades the image quality. This is something that many people don’t consider. In my experience, the ability to fine-tune your image with different lenses is invaluable. Manual control is another important advantage. While phone cameras offer some manual settings, they are often limited. Dedicated cameras give you full control over aperture, shutter speed, and ISO, allowing you to create exactly the image you envision.
The AI Advantage: How Algorithms are Revolutionizing Night Photography
AI is undeniably the secret sauce behind the incredible night photography capabilities of modern smartphones. It’s not just about capturing more light. It’s about intelligent processing and enhancement. Phones use sophisticated algorithms to analyze the scene, identify different elements, and then optimize the image accordingly. For example, AI can detect faces and brighten them without overexposing the rest of the scene. It can also reduce noise, sharpen details, and enhance colors, all automatically. I think this is the real magic of phone photography. It transforms ordinary snapshots into stunning works of art with minimal effort.
One technique that’s particularly effective is called “multi-frame processing.” Your phone rapidly captures multiple images with different exposures and then combines them into a single, well-balanced shot. The AI analyzes each frame and selects the best parts to create the final image. This process helps to overcome the limitations of small sensors.
